"Chirichouzu" is a gesture wrestlers use to prove that they are unarmed. In the squatting position, they rub their palms in front of their body twice and clap once. Then they open their arms wide with palms facing up. As the arms stretch out, the palms turn to face downward. "Chirichouzu" was also done in the olden days when purifying the hands by scrubbing them with grass.
